Русское сообщество разработки на PHP-фреймворке Laravel.
Ты не вошёл. Вход тут.
Страницы 1
Здравствуйте всем.
Заранее извиняюсь, если вопрос нубский, только начинаю изучать Laravel.
Я пытаюсь написать тесты для страницы логина. Пытаюсь проверить работу формы, то есть для начала проверить, что если форма не заполнена, то в сессию попадут ошибки.
Код
public function testFormErrors(): void
{
$response = $this->post('/login', [
'email' => '',
'password' => '',
]);
$response
->assertStatus(302)
->assertSessionHasErrors(['email', 'password']);
}
Вроде все как положено, но в ответ прилетает Tests\Feature\Auth\LoginTest::testErrors Expected status code 302 but received 419.
В форме, естественно, токен есть.
И такая фигня происходит со всеми post запросами. Get запросы проходят.
Подскажите, пожалуйста, в какую сторону копать то?
Не в сети
Страницы 1